    Is there a reason you can not logout, so the problem never exists? What if
    the third-party support used terminal services to logon?

    > Does someone know a way to allow a normal user to
    > release a server password protected screen-saver
    > without giving the user the administrator password?
    >
    > I need this so that third-party support can access
    > our server via GoToMyPC when I am not there. The
    > password protected screen-saver blocks them from
    > remote access to fix problems. I cannot always be
    > on-site to assist by supplying the screen-saver
    > password.
